Distance
The distance between Burnaby and Fairmont Hot Springs is approximately 540 kilometers (335 miles).
How to Reach
There are a few different ways to reach Fairmont Hot Springs from Burnaby.
- By car: The drive takes approximately 6 hours and 30 minutes.
- By bus: There are a few different bus companies that offer service between Burnaby and Fairmont Hot Springs. The trip takes approximately 8 hours.
- By train: There is no direct train service between Burnaby and Fairmont Hot Springs. However, you can take a train to Kamloops and then transfer to a bus.

Best time to go
The best time to visit Fairmont Hot Springs is during the summer months (June-August). However, the springs are open year-round.

Where to Go
In addition to the hot springs, there are a number of other attractions in Fairmont Hot Springs. Here are a few of the most popular:
- The Columbia River Wetlands: A large wetland area with a variety of hiking trails and birdwatching opportunities.
- The Fairmont Hot Springs Golf Course: An 18-hole golf course with stunning mountain views.
- The Fairmont Hot Springs Resort: A full-service resort with a variety of amenities, including a spa, a fitness center, and a pool.
